Alternatively, cell proliferation can also be analyzed with cell viability assays that measure the rate of cellular metabolism, such as MTT, MTS, resazurin and similar assays, mitochondrial membrane potential dependent dyes, cellular esterase cleaved dyes, ATP and ADP assays, and assays that measure glycolytic flux and oxygen consumption. BrdU Cell Proliferation Assay This proliferation assay is a non-isotopic immunoassay for quantification of BrdU incorporation into newly synthesized DNA of actively proliferating cells.

Measuring the synthesis of new DNA is a precise way to assay cell proliferation in individual cells or in cell populations. The rate of new DNA synthesis can be based on incorporation of a nucleoside analog such as BrdU or EdU into DNA. DNA synthesis cell proliferation assays. During S phase, nucleoside labeling agents such as 3H-thymidine or 5-bromo-2'-deoxyuridine are incorporated into newly synthesized DNA. Cell proliferation assays are mainly divided into four methods: metabolic activity assays, cell proliferation marker assays, ATP concentration assays, and DNA synthesis assays.
